Preliminary Agreement To Set Effective Date for Wage Rates

B-183083 Nov 28, 1975

Clarification was requested of earlier decisions concerning the effective implementation date of certain negotiated wage schedules of the agency's employees. The union desired to agree in advance to the effective date of the new wage agreement while continuing to bargain over the rate, but the agency claimed that such a preliminary agreement must contain an independently ascertainable standard for the wage rate in order to avoid the ban on retroactive wage increases. It is permissable for the agency to agree in advance on an effective date to implement wages yet to be negotiated when the agreed-upon date is not earlier than the date of the preliminary agreement.
